Mettawas Station Mediterranean Restaurant

There’s nothing better then dining al fresco, out on the patio with the wind blowing in your hair, the smell of the outdoors. But Anthony Del Brocco of Mettawas Station in Kingsville is taking it to another level hosting Winter Wonderland, an outdoor feast in the middle of winter on January 28, 2011.

“We were looking for a different kind of event to add a little bit of excitement to the January blahs,” Anthony explains. “What better way than to dine outside and enjoy some wine with your friends. Our guests thoroughly enjoy the experience and uniqueness of this event.”

Unique it is. The menu for the event is always a surprise but are always a mixture of classic and creative. Last year Wild Boar was on the menu. The meal will be 6 courses: an appetizer, soup, salad, pasta, main and dessert and will feature seafood, poultry, red meat and a vegetarian dish.

“We always try to create our menu thinking outside the box to make a tantalizing and memorable experience,” he says. “You never know, if the dish is a raving success it may even appear on our regular menu.”

For those worried about the elements, fear not. The restaurant does have patio heaters and enclose the area with trees to block the wind.

Tickets now available $100 per person and includes dinner and a wine pairing with each course. All wines used during the event will come from an Essex County winery.
